Harlingen (Texas)–Cameron County Judge Eddie Trevino announced at a press conference last week that the county will be making mandatory the use of face coverings starting Monday.
According to Judge Trevino, facial coverings items can be bandanas , sewn or cloth face coverings, handkerchiefs, or a piece of clothing.
The mandate also includes social distancing of six feet apart. All travel deemed essential shall be limited to no more than two people per vehicle. If possible, limit travel to only one person in a vehicle. If more than one person is in a vehicle, facemasks are required for all occupants.
No children under 14 may accompany parents or guardians for routine grocery, supplies or gasoline replenishing trips. Situations may vary when it comes to a parent or guarding being a single parent.
Violations of the order could result in arrest and a fine up to $1,000.
